I guess most people just post a picture of their machine and some brief details of what the mods actually do and some samples or videos of the thing in action. If anyone wants more detials of exactly how each mod was done or anything more specific they will probably ask.
Having said that, if you do have some kind of wiring diagram or schematic already then its always handy to post it in an archiving sense in case anyone else come searching for the same machine.
